
Leicester Eyes Russell Martin to Reignite Championship Glory
So here’s something interesting—Leicester City seem to be setting the stage for a pretty bold managerial move, and guess who’s at the center of it? Russell Martin. Yep, the very same guy who helped Southampton get back into the Premier League not too long ago. After a rocky exit from St Mary’s, Martin is now being seriously considered to take over at Leicester, as they prepare for another run in the Championship next season. And honestly, the irony here is just chef’s kiss .
Let’s talk context for a second. Leicester and Southampton have been neck and neck in recent seasons, almost mirroring each other's ups and downs, especially after their respective Premier League stints. But now, with Leicester likely to drop back into the Championship, they’re wasting no time thinking about the future—and Martin’s possession-heavy style has caught their eye. Despite being let go by Southampton after a rough patch, he’s still respected for his tactical approach and ability to lead a side to promotion. Clearly, Leicester believe lightning can strike twice, even if it means borrowing from a recent rival’s playbook.

Now, imagine that twist—Martin, once hailed at Southampton for guiding them to top-tier football, could now be leading their closest competitor in a bid to leapfrog them again . If this move goes through, it’ll definitely sting for Saints fans, especially since some of them were already questioning Martin’s dismissal in the first place.
But let’s not forget, this is football. One club’s loss is another club’s opportunity, and Leicester seem poised to take full advantage. They’re not just looking for a manager—they’re looking for a tactical identity that aligns with their recent direction under Enzo Maresca. And Russell Martin’s possession-based philosophy fits that bill. In fact, stats from last season show Southampton under Martin had even higher possession than Maresca’s Leicester. That’s saying something.
Of course, Leicester aren’t putting all their eggs in one basket. Other names are floating around—Sean Dyche, Liam Rosenior, Danny Rohl—but Martin seems to check a lot of boxes. There’s even talk that the City Football Group has an eye on him, which speaks volumes about how he’s perceived across the footballing world.
So what does this mean for Southampton? Well, if Leicester do get Martin and make a strong push in the Championship, Saints might just have to brace themselves for some déjà vu. There’s even buzz about them countering with someone like Danny Rohl. This could shape up to be a compelling Championship rivalry—same ambitions, same managers swapping sides, and the same relentless drive to return to the big league.
Bottom line: Leicester’s targeting of Russell Martin isn’t just a managerial change. It’s a statement. They’re watching their rivals, learning from them, and if all goes to plan, ready to beat them at their own game.
